this looks fun but i echo the groans on the environment and character types.... same ol', same ol'. the problem i have, with the environment-only screenshot for example, is how much the generi-future setting is killing all the believable details. HL2 of course had a very believable setting filled with all manner of little details, and even Doom 3 (when it isn't monster closet-ing you) is chock full of believable scene-setting. the screenshots from this just look like computer game worlds.
i have no problem with essentially going with the same old story (HL2 is still basically your classic invasion story with elements of 1984)... just please invest the world with authentic-seeming details that make sense in that world.

Anyways the cool thing about this game is that its going to be community driven, we'll be able to determine how people play the game and based on the overal "reaction" (stats) and adjust the story/gameplay accordingly. Also keep in mind this is episode one, and our team is really small so we're just getting the basics in, once thats all in we'll be able to focus on cool bosses and kickass new locations and weapons. I mean this thing is only going to get better. Plus you won't have to wait years to see it all come together.
